Understanding Boiler Blowdown
Blowdown is necessary to control dissolved solids in boiler water. Excessive blowdown wastes water, heat, and chemicals, while insufficient blowdown can cause scaling and corrosion.

About TDS Control
The blowdown rate is determined by the ratio of feedwater TDS to boiler water TDS. Higher TDS in feedwater requires more blowdown to maintain safe boiler water concentration levels.

Blowdown Calculation Formula
Blowdown % = (Feedwater TDS / (Boiler Water TDS – Feedwater TDS)) × 100
The blowdown rate is calculated based on the concentration of dissolved solids. Proper blowdown control optimizes boiler efficiency while preventing scale formation and corrosion.
